What makes nim-lang.org unique compared to its competitors?

The Nim language emphasizes a combination of high performance (compiled code), expressive, Python‑like syntax, powerful compile‑time metaprogramming, and flexible memory management, which differentiates it from many competitors. The project also targets multiple backends (C, C++, JavaScript) and a lightweight toolchain, appealing to developers who want a systems-level language with high-level ergonomics.
